Ambulatory surgery centers provide an alternative to hospitalization for patients undergoing surgical procedures. Surgery centers provide outpatient surgery services, typically at less cost and with greater convenience than a traditional hospital setting. Before surgery, our client was active and in good health. He attended regular medical appointments and followed his physician’s recommendations. He was advised that robotic surgery for a routine procedure would reduce pain and recovery time, and he agreed to proceed based on that information.
During the procedure, a critical artery was mistakenly sewn shut, compromising blood flow to the heart. The patient, who had no prior heart disease, suffered permanent cardiac damage and is now on the heart transplant list.
This injury was not the result of an unavoidable complication. It involved failures in surgical technique, judgment, oversight, and risk management, as well as reliance on technology without appropriate safeguards. The surgeon had previously injured other patients using the same system.

Unlike hospitals, surgery centers are typically owned by physicians or physician groups. They may not have rigorous risk management procedures in place to minimize patient risk. Common surgery center errors include:
Failure to properly sterilize equipment: When detailed guidelines for sterilizing surgical areas and equipment are lacking, patients may face the risk of serious infection.The doctor, surgery center, or another party may be liable for a patient’s injuries caused by medical error, depending on what caused the injury and whether the doctor is an owner, employee, or private contractor. After serious injuries caused by surgery center errors, you may be entitled to recover economic and non-economic damages. Economic damages include past and future medical expenses, lost wages, and loss of earning potential. Non-economic damages include fewer tangible losses, such as pain and suffering, mental anguish, and emotional distress. In Oregon, unlike other states, there is no cap on non-economic damages for medical malpractices claims, with the exception of wrongful death lawsuits in Portland.
